Read the following paragraph from the section "On The Fence."

Reasons for supporting either side varied. The British understood the need to build up colonial popular support for the loyalist cause. Some colonists joined either cause simply for personal gain or military glory. The American colonists were British citizens, after all. Those who supported Britain might have felt a deep sense of loyalty and patriotism to the mother country. Some colonial farmers profited from selling goods to British forces. Other farmers profited by selling to the patriots.

What conclusion is BEST supported by the paragraph above?
